  • How is the weather in Victor?

    Victor has cold, snowy winters with temperatures averaging 2–24°F (-17 to -5°C) in January, and milder, drier summers reaching around 79°F (26°C) in July. Be prepared for rapid shifts, especially in spring and fall.
